Frequently Asked Questions

Is Walnut Hill a good place to live?
Walnut Hill is a good place to live. Walnut Hill is considered somewhat walkable and bikeable with some transit options. Walnut Hill is a suburban neighborhood with a crime score of 2, making it safer than the average neighborhood in the U.S. Walnut Hill has 10 parks for recreational activities. It is fairly sparse in population with 4.0 people per acre and a median age of 41. The average household income is $125,246 which is above the national average. College graduates make up 53.4% of residents. A majority of residents in Walnut Hill are home owners, with 44% of residents renting and 56% of residents owning their home. How much do you need to make to afford a house in Walnut Hill?
The median home price in Walnut Hill is $889,999. If you put a 20% down payment of $178,000 and had a 30-year fixed mortgage with an interest rate of 6.69%, your estimated principal and interest payment would be $4,590 a month plus property taxes, HOA fees, home insurance, PMI, and utilities. Using the 28% rule, you would need to make at least $197K a year to afford the median home price in Walnut Hill. Learn how much home you can afford with our Home Affordability Calculator. The average household income in Walnut Hill is $125K.
